When choosing enrichment chews and foraging toys for exotic mammals, consider species-specific dental anatomy, chewing styles, and natural behaviors. Mildly abrasive textures help wear down plaque and maintain enamel integrity, while size and shape should prevent choking hazards and encourage controlled gnawing. Avoid bulkiness that traps saliva or fragments that can splinter. Opt for materials with predictable ingestible safety profiles, and check for potential allergen exposure in bedding or additives. Introduce enrichment gradually, monitoring the animal’s response to stimulating scents, textures, and sounds. Providing a range of options over weeks helps identify which options the animal prefers while supporting healthy mastication and cognitive engagement.
To maximize dental benefits, rotate chews and foraging toys to maintain novelty and prevent desensitization. A balanced mix might include natural wooden chews, compressed sisal or rope toys, and puzzle feeders that require problem-solving to access edible rewards. Ensure all items are appropriately sized for the animal’s jaw strength and mouth opening. Regularly inspect for wear and tear, removing pieces that could be swallowed or lodged in the mouth or throat. For species prone to dental disease, pairing enrichment with scheduled dental checks by a veterinarian reinforces early detection and promotes owner confidence. Documentation of preferences helps tailor future enrichment plans effectively.
Rotating textures and challenges sustains interaction and dental benefits.
A thoughtful enrichment plan begins by matching materials to an animal’s natural diet and foraging behavior. For herbivorous exotics like certain rabbits or guinea pigs, plant-based chews with safe fiber content aid digestion and reduce boredom-induced aggression. For small mammals that gnaw aggressively, harder composites such as safe hardwoods can promote robust tooth wear without risk of splinters. For omnivorous species, a combination of fruit-scented fibers and mineral-impregnated chews may be appropriate, provided sugar content is limited. Always confirm item safety with a veterinary guide and supervise initial interactions to ensure the animal samples contents correctly and does not develop an aversion to any texture or taste.

Foraging toys that encourage problem-solving mirror natural scavenging and help slow eating, which is good for dental health and digestion. Treat-dispenser balls and maze feeders should be large enough to prevent accidental swallowing but engaging enough to hold attention for extended periods. Use a schedule that blends quiet, solitary exploration with social play if appropriate to the species and household dynamics. Avoid pieces with moving parts that can detach and become choking hazards. Keep enrichment surfaces clean and dry between sessions to prevent mold growth or bacteria transfer. Document which mechanisms consistently lead to longer engagement and better dental outcomes for ongoing refinement.
Consistency helps guardians evaluate dental health benefits over time.
When evaluating safety, confirm that chews come from non-toxic, sustainably sourced materials free of pesticides or heavy metals. Wood should be untreated or treated with veterinary-approved finishes that are safe if ingested. Avoid items with glue, nails, cords, or small detachable components that could be swallowed. Enrichment should avoid fibers that easily shed and create ingestion risks in small animals. Some species may require dental strips or mineral blocks; if offered, supervise to ensure gradual consumption and to avoid overuse. If a chew breaks, inspect the fragment and decide whether it remains safe or should be removed. Always provide fresh water during enrichment to support oral health.

Foraging toys can integrate natural textures like sisal, seagrass, or cotton fibers, but only if they are non-dyed and free from artificial coatings. Check for signs of wear after each session, such as frayed edges or loose stitching, and retire items before fragments appear. Introduce enrichment after a small meal to optimize chewing motivation and digestion, but avoid post-meal overexertion. Consider environmental enrichment as well: puzzle feeders placed at different heights or hiding spots behind safe barriers replicate natural foraging routes and reduce stress. Pair toys with gentle handling by caregivers to reinforce positive associations and increase the likelihood of ongoing use.
Safety, species-fit design, and caregiver monitoring are essential.
Species-specific testing is essential because dental anatomy varies widely among exotic mammals. Rodents with continuously growing incisors benefit from hard but safely textured chews that promote wear without causing fractures. Rabbits and chinchillas require materials that discourage overgrowth of any one tooth surface while also avoiding dental malocclusion. Hedgehogs and sugar gliders may prefer tactile woolly textures or soft chews that support chewing but do not irritate sensitive gums. When introducing new items, observe jaw movement, chewing direction, and any audible discomfort. Recording these observations assists veterinarians in understanding how enrichment affects the animal’s dental alignment and comfort.
The practical design of enrichment should also consider house layout and safety. Place foraging toys away from high-traffic areas to minimize stress and accidental damage. Use positive reinforcement to reward successful interaction, reinforcing desirable chewing behavior and reducing instances of destructive mouthing elsewhere. Rotate scents by using natural aromas like safe fruit extracts or herb infusions to maintain novelty. Always supervise initial exposure, especially with novel textures or multi-part items that could be disassembled. If the animal shows reluctance, reassess the item’s size, texture, and odor and adapt accordingly, ensuring that enrichment remains an inviting, low-stress part of daily care.

Long-term success comes from tailored plans and ongoing assessment.
For reliable maintenance of dental health, pair enrichment with routine dental care appropriate to the species. This means dental checks at veterinarian visits and home assessments of tooth wear. Gentle percussive cleaning in some species can be appropriate if guided by a professional, while others benefit most from sustained chewing activity that wears down enamel at a healthy rate. Be mindful of sugar content, especially in fruit-based chews, to prevent dental caries or obesity. Establish a predictable enrichment schedule that aligns with daily routines, reducing stress and helping the animal anticipate rewards. Clear communication with caregivers ensures consistent implementation and better long-term outcomes.
Environmental enrichment should also be scalable to growing animals. Young exotics that are still developing dentition require softer, more varied textures to avoid cracking or undue stress on developing teeth. As animals mature, progressively introduce tougher materials that encourage stronger wear without harming the mouth. Monitor weight and condition alongside dental health, as mouth pain can alter eating behavior and overall wellbeing. Collaboration with a veterinary dental specialist can help tailor a dynamic plan that evolves with the animal’s physiology and environment, ensuring the enrichment remains effective and safe across life stages.
Finally, educate all caregivers about recognizing signs of dental distress. Changes in eating habits, drooling, facial swelling, abnormal chewing sounds, or reluctance to chew can indicate dental problems requiring veterinary attention. Ensure enrichment choices are age-appropriate and culturally acceptable within the household, avoiding any items that pose allergen or toxin risks. Document preferences, responses, and any adverse events to allow continuing refinement. A well-structured enrichment program should feel like play rather than a chore, supporting exploration, cognitive engagement, and dental health. When consistent, these practices improve quality of life for exotic mammals.
In summary, safe enrichment chews and foraging toys function as proactive tools for dental health and overall welfare. By prioritizing species-specific needs, materials safety, chewability, and cognitive challenge, guardians can create enriching routines that mimic natural behaviors. Regular veterinary input ensures plans remain current and effective. Emphasize gradual introduction, ongoing monitoring, and thoughtful rotation to maintain interest without overwhelming the animal. With patience and attention to detail, enrichment becomes a reliable cornerstone of responsible exotic-mammal care, promoting cleaner teeth, comfortable chewing, and happier, more curious companions.
